Here are the essential units for a Professional Certificate in Chemical Security Incident Management Strategies:
• Chemical Risk Assessment: Understanding the dangers of chemical hazards and how to assess and mitigate potential risks in the workplace.
• Chemical Security Planning: Developing a comprehensive chemical security plan to prevent and respond to security incidents.
• Chemical Storage and Handling: Proper techniques for storing and handling chemicals to prevent accidents and ensure safety.
• Chemical Emergency Response: Best practices for responding to chemical emergencies, including evacuation procedures and first aid measures.
• Cybersecurity for Chemical Facilities: Protecting chemical facilities from cyber threats and ensuring the security of digital systems.
• Chemical Supply Chain Security: Strategies for securing the chemical supply chain and preventing theft or diversion of chemicals.
• Incident Management: Effective incident management strategies for chemical security incidents, including communication, investigation, and recovery.
• Legal and Regulatory Compliance: Understanding and complying with legal and regulatory requirements related to chemical security and incident management.
